Trading nuggets that go beyond the usual “manage your risk” advice
1. The market doesn’t pay you for being right; it pays you for being positioned correctly when you’re right.
2. A losing trade is information. A repeated losing pattern is a lack of adaptation.
3. Your biggest enemy isn’t volatility, it’s your inability to remain consistent when volatility changes.
4. If you need the next trade to recover the last loss, you’re no longer trading the market; you’re trading your emotions.
5. A setup can be perfect and still lose. Your job is to execute the process, not predict the outcome.
6. Most traders study entries because entries feel exciting. Professionals obsess over invalidation because that’s where risk is defined.
7. The best trade you take might be the one you deliberately refuse to take.
8. Profitability often begins when you stop asking, “How much can I make?” and start asking, “What would make this idea wrong?”
9. If your strategy only works when you feel confident, you don’t have a strategy, you have a mood-dependent system.
10. The market exposes impatience faster than it exposes ignorance.
